US Economy Drops to Historic Low at 32.9% after Taking a Full-Quarter Hit from Pandemic

The U.S. economy faced its worst quarterly plummet in history after reporting a 32.9% contraction for the period of April – June.

 

The gross domestic product (GDP) in the second quarter plunged 32.9%, slightly better than a drop of 34.7%, forecasted by economists.

The U.S. took a full-quarter hit from the coronavirus outbreak that began to weigh on its late first-quarter economic growth, dragging the GDP to a 5% contraction. To this day, the U.S. remains one of the coronavirus hotspots with the highest confirmed cases and fatalities in the world.
